Alice Ann (Lamons) Hamby was born December 10, 1940 and went home to be with her Lord and Savior Jesus Christ on November 6th, 2025. She passed peacefully with her family by her side.
The daughter of John Newton (Buster) Lamons and Emma Sevola (Jordan) Lamons, Alice Ann was the seventh child of seven children. She attended Tahlequah Public Schools and business classes at NSU. Alice Ann was a secretary for a number of years at Ozark Nursery and Keys School, then retired from Cherokee Nation Housing Authority after 34 years.
Alice Ann's family was her life and she was never short on sacrificing anything for them. Her heart was so big that many were considered part of her extended family, donning her the endearing nickname of "Mama Alice". If you were lucky enough to be blessed as someone that Alice loved, in her eyes, you could do no wrong and she would never hesitate to stand up for you to anyone that questioned that. The only thing that could outshine her model-like beauty, was her wit. She was a trivia wiz and could finish any crossword puzzle she started. The only thing that trumped her wit, was her unwavering kindness. She was happiest when her family gathered together for holiday meals and big family breakfasts. She never missed rooting for her children, grandchildren, and great grandchildren at their many ball games or activities, if she could help it. She was everyone's biggest fan. Mama Alice was an angel that God let us borrow for a while and anyone who knew her is lucky to have been shaped by her influence and love.
Alice Ann was preceded in death by her mother and father, the father of her children, Estel Hamby, her sister Ila Mae Lamons, her brother and sister-in-law Garl Gene & Ruth Lamons, her brother and sister-in-law Leroy & Verlene Lamons and nephew Johnny Lamons, her sister and brother-in-law Virginia & Otis Hoffman and niece Mary (Hoffman) Roach, her brother and sister-in-law Tommy & Geraldine Lamons, and brother Billie Lamons. Alice Ann is survived by her three children, Sherry Qualls (Leroy) of Tahlequah, OK, Chris Hamby (Kathy) of Saint Louis, MO, and Bret Hamby (Cheryl) of Tahlequah, OK; Six grandchildren, Amber Hamby, Ashley (Hamby) Conger, Zachary Hamby (Brittney), David Qualls (Paiten), Jeremy Hamby (Heidi), and Matthew Qualls (Stevie); Eleven great grandchildren, Natalie & Harper Qualls, Olivia, Evelyn, & Emmitt Hamby, Kline & Milo Conger, Elias & Sage Hamby, Katherine & Leighton Qualls, sister-in-law Dyanne Lamons, close friends Pudge and Jody Ketcher, and many other relatives, friends, and loved ones who will miss her dearly.
The family of Alice Ann Hamby would like to express their sincere thanks to Cherokee Nation Home Health and Hospice staff.
